WebJun 3, 2015 · First Outbreak. The first herpes outbreak often occurs within the 2 weeks after contracting the virus from an infected person. The first signs may include: Itching, tingling, or burning feeling in the vaginal or anal area. Flu-like symptoms, including fever. Swollen glands. Pain in the legs, buttocks, or vaginal area. WebThe symptoms of genital herpes often go away and come back as recurring outbreaks. For most people, the first outbreak is the worst, and can last from two to three weeks. Future flare-ups are often less severe and do not last as long. Still, some people shed the virus regularly.
